This factory is completely gone. The red pin marks the former location.

A view of what was originally the Sheffield Car Company complex established in 1881. Sheffield merged with the Fairbanks-Morse Co. in 1918. Essex Wire (A division of the Midland Wire Corp) took over the site in the 1960s. Decatur Elevator used the facility for grain storage from the late 1980s thru 1992. The City of Three Rivers acquired the property in 1995. It was sold to Clark Logic in 2011.

The building in the lower right was Fiber Converters. In the bunch of trees between the railroad lines and Broadway were two houses. I lived in one of them in the 1980s. The white building on the right was the junkyard.
